Comparable Facts
Compare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ary in Wake Forest, NC with University of North Georgia in Dahlonega, GA on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
University of North Georgia is larger than SEBTS based on total student enrollment (19,291 students vs. 3,220 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ary is located in Wake Forest, NC (Large Suburban setting); University of North Georgia is in Dahlonega, GA (Distant Town setting).
-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. University of North Georgia is a public,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ary 9:1; University of North Georgia 19:1.
SEBTS vs. UNG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, SEBTS or UNG?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of North Georgia than SEBTS ($11,157 vs. $16,031).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ary are 44.2% lower than at University of North Georgia ($7,123 vs. $12,770).
-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ary is 114.2% more expensive for in-state tuition than UNG (about $6,033 more per year; $11,318.00 vs. $5,285.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 45.8% higher at UNG than at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ary (about $5,185 more per year; $16,503.00 vs. $11,318.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at University of North Georgia than at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ary (87% vs. 71%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by University of North Georgia students is 7.3% larger than aid received by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ary students ($7,226 vs. $6,736).
SEBTS vs. UNG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, SEBTS or UNG?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between UNG and SEBTS.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ary (1130) is 30 points higher than at UNG (1100).
- Incoming SEBTS students have the same typical ACT composite (median estimate; 22) as students at UNG (22).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ary 1000/1250; University of North Georgia 980/1210.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ary 21/24; University of North Georgia 19/25.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: SEBTS - Test optional; UNG - Test optional.
- Typical fall application deadline: UNG Feb 15, 2027.
- SEBTS has a higher acceptance rate (74.6%) than UNG (67.9%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 78.7% at SEBTS vs. 47.9% at UNG.
